Sox8 is a member of the Sox family of developmental transcription factor genes and is
closely related to Sox9, a key gene in the testis determination pathway in mammals. Like
Sox9, Sox8 is expressed in the developing mouse testis around the time of sex
determination, suggesting that it might play a role in regulating the expression of testis-
specific genes. An early step in male sex differentiation is the expression of anti-Müllerian
